California SB 653 (20252026) — Wildfire prevention: environmentally sensitive vegetation management.

Existing law requires the Department of Forestry and Fire Protection, in accordance with policies established by the State Board of Forestry and Fire Protection, to assist local governments in preventing future high-intensity wildland fires and instituting appropriate fuels management by making its wildland fire prevention and vegetation management expertise available to local governments, as provided.

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2025-02-20 Introduced. Read first time. To Com. on RLS. for assignment. To print. introduction, reading-1
  • 2025-02-21 From printer. May be acted upon on or after March 23.
  • 2025-03-05 Referred to Com. on RLS. referral-committee
  • 2025-03-24 From committee with author's amendments. Read second time and amended. Re-referred to Com. on RLS. amendment-passage, committee-passage, reading-1, reading-2, referral-committee
  • 2025-04-02 Re-referred to Com. on N.R. & W. referral-committee
  • 2025-04-04 Set for hearing April 22.
  • 2025-04-10 From committee with author's amendments. Read second time and amended. Re-referred to Com. on N.R. & W. amendment-passage, committee-passage, reading-1, reading-2, referral-committee
  • 2025-04-23 From committee: Do pass and re-refer to Com. on APPR. (Ayes 5. Noes 0. Page 839.) (April 22). Re-referred to Com. on APPR. committ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able, referral-committee
  • 2025-04-25 Set for hearing May 5.
  • 2025-05-05 May 5 hearing: Placed on APPR. suspense file.
  • 2025-05-16 Set for hearing May 23.
  • 2025-05-23 From committee: Do pass as amended. (Ayes 5. Noes 0. Page 1208.) (May 23). amendment-passage, committ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able
  • 2025-05-23 Read second time and amended. Ordered to second reading. amendment-passage, reading-1, reading-2
  • 2025-05-27 Read second time. Ordered to third reading. reading-1, reading-2
  • 2025-05-29 Read third time. Passed. (Ayes 36. Noes 0. Page 1338.) Ordered to the Assembly. passage, reading-1, reading-3
  • 2025-05-29 In Assembly. Read first time. Held at Desk. reading-1
  • 2025-06-05 Referred to Com. on NAT. RES. referral-committee
  • 2025-06-24 From committee: Do pass as amended. (Ayes 13. Noes 0.) (June 23). amendment-passage, committ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able
  • 2025-06-25 Read second time and amended. Ordered to second reading. amendment-passage, reading-1, reading-2
  • 2025-06-26 Read second time. Ordered to third reading. reading-1, reading-2
  • 2025-06-26 Re-referred to Com. on APPR. pursuant to Joint Rule 10.5. referral-committee
  • 2025-07-09 July 9 set for first hearing. Placed on APPR. suspense file.
  • 2025-08-29 Coauthors revised.
  • 2025-08-29 From committee: Do pass. (Ayes 14. Noes 0.) (August 29). committ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able
  • 2025-09-02 Read second time. Ordered to third reading. reading-1, reading-2
  • 2025-09-03 Read third time. Passed. (Ayes 71. Noes 1. Page 2870.) Ordered to the Senate. passage, reading-1, reading-3
  • 2025-09-03 In Senate. Concurrence in Assembly amendments pending.
  • 2025-09-08 Assembly amendments concurred in. (Ayes 37. Noes 0. Page 2606.) Ordered to engrossing and enrolling. amendment-passage, committee-passage-favorable
  • 2025-09-16 Enrolled and presented to the Governor at 3 p.m.
  • 2025-10-13 Approved by the Governor. executive-signature
  • 2025-10-13 Chaptered by Secretary of State. Chapter 778, Statutes of 2025. became-law
